一、技术突破的背景与意义
2018年,人工智能技术从实验室走向产业化的关键节点。这一年,深度学习框架的成熟、算力的指数级提升以及大规模数据集的开放,推动了AI技术在多领域的突破性进展。无论是自然语言处理的语义理解,还是计算机视觉的实时识别,均出现了可商业落地的技术方案。本文将从技术原理、应用场景、实现难点三个维度,解析2018年全球AI领域的十大核心突破。
二、2018年全球AI十大突破性技术详解
1. BERT:自然语言处理的预训练革命
- 技术原理:BERT(Bidirectional Encoder Representations from Transformers)通过双向Transformer架构,首次实现“掩码语言模型”(MLM)和“下一句预测”(NSP)的联合训练,解决了传统单向模型(如LSTM)无法捕捉上下文依赖的问题。
- 代码示例(简化版MLM训练逻辑):
def mask_language_model(tokens):masked_tokens = tokens.copy()for i in range(len(tokens)):if random.random() < 0.15: # 15%概率掩码masked_tokens[i] = "[MASK]"return masked_tokens
- 应用场景:搜索问答、智能客服、文本分类等需要深度语义理解的场景。
- 实现难点:预训练阶段对算力要求极高,需依赖分布式训练框架(如某主流云服务商的分布式TensorFlow方案)。
2. GANs的稳定训练:从理论到实用
- 技术突破:2018年,WGAN-GP(Wasserstein GAN with Gradient Penalty)和BigGAN等变体解决了传统GAN训练中的模式崩溃问题,通过梯度惩罚和渐进式生成策略,显著提升了图像生成的稳定性和质量。
- 实践建议:
- 使用谱归一化(Spectral Normalization)约束判别器权重。
- 逐步增加生成器输入噪声的维度(Progressive Growing)。
- 典型应用:图像修复、超分辨率重建、虚拟试衣等。
3. 强化学习的分布式扩展:Impala架构
- 技术原理:Impala(Importance Weighted Actor-Learner Architecture)通过异步参数更新和经验回放机制,解决了传统A3C算法的样本效率问题,支持数千个Actor并行采集数据。
- 性能优化:
- 使用批处理(Batching)减少通信开销。
- 结合PPO(Proximal Policy Optimization)算法提升策略稳定性。
- 适用场景:游戏AI、机器人控制、自动驾驶决策系统。
4. 3D点云处理:PointNet++的突破
- 技术亮点:PointNet++通过分层特征提取和局部空间编码,解决了点云数据的无序性和稀疏性问题,成为自动驾驶激光雷达感知的核心算法。
- 代码片段(点云局部特征聚合):
def local_feature_aggregation(points, radius):neighbors = []for point in points:dist = np.linalg.norm(points - point, axis=1)neighbors.append(points[dist < radius])return neighbors
- 挑战:需结合GPU加速库(如CUDA)优化邻域搜索效率。
5. 语音合成的自然度飞跃:Tacotron 2
- 技术原理:Tacotron 2结合编码器-解码器结构和WaveNet声码器,直接从文本生成接近人类发音的语音波形,替代了传统拼接式TTS(Text-to-Speech)的机械感。
- 关键参数:
- 注意力机制中的位置编码(Positional Encoding)。
- 声码器的采样率需≥16kHz以保证高频细节。
- 商业落地:智能音箱、有声读物生成。
6. 图神经网络(GNN)的工业化应用
- 技术突破:GraphSAGE和GAT(Graph Attention Network)通过采样邻居节点和注意力权重分配,解决了大规模图数据训练的内存瓶颈,广泛应用于社交网络推荐和金融风控。
- 架构设计:
- 邻居采样层(Neighbor Sampling)减少计算图规模。
- 多头注意力机制提升特征表达能力。
7. 超分辨率重建:ESRGAN的视觉突破
- 技术原理:ESRGAN(Enhanced Super-Resolution GAN)通过相对平均判别器(RaD)和残差密集块(RDB),生成了纹理更真实的超分图像,替代了传统SRCNN的模糊输出。
- 对比实验:在PSNR指标上超越SRGAN 1.2dB,在用户主观评分中提升23%。
8. 多模态学习:CLIP的跨模态对齐
- 技术亮点:CLIP(Contrastive Language–Image Pre-training)通过对比学习,将图像和文本映射到同一嵌入空间,实现了“零样本”图像分类(Zero-shot Classification)。
- 训练数据:需4亿对图文对(如某平台公开数据集)。
- 应用场景:跨模态检索、内容审核。
9. 轻量化模型:MobileNetV3的硬件适配
- 技术优化:MobileNetV3结合神经架构搜索(NAS)和硬件感知设计(如ARM CPU指令集优化),在保持95%准确率的同时,模型体积缩小至3MB。
- 部署建议:
- 使用TensorFlow Lite进行量化压缩。
- 针对不同硬件(如DSP、NPU)定制算子。
10. 自监督学习的崛起:SimCLR框架
- 技术原理:SimCLR通过对比学习(Contrastive Learning)和强数据增强(如随机裁剪、颜色抖动),在无标签数据上学习到可迁移的特征表示,减少了对标注数据的依赖。
- 实验结果:在ImageNet上,仅用1%标签即可达到ResNet-50的80%准确率。
三、技术落地的关键挑战与建议
-
数据隐私与合规性:
- 联邦学习(Federated Learning)可实现数据不出域的训练。
- 差分隐私(Differential Privacy)需控制噪声添加比例(如ε≤10)。
-
模型可解释性:
- 使用SHAP值或LIME解释黑盒模型决策。
- 在金融、医疗等高风险领域强制要求可解释性报告。
-
边缘计算适配:
- 模型剪枝(Pruning)和量化(Quantization)需平衡精度与延迟。
- 参考某主流云服务商的边缘AI开发套件进行部署。
四、未来趋势展望
2018年的技术突破为后续AI发展奠定了基础:预训练模型的跨模态扩展、强化学习的工业级落地、轻量化模型的硬件协同设计将成为核心方向。开发者需关注框架的易用性(如PyTorch的动态图模式)和算力的性价比(如某云厂商的GPU实例优化方案),以实现技术到产品的快速转化。